Kali 中 Python 3 模块所在位置
引言
Kali Linux 是一款以安全性为中心的 Linux 发行版,为渗透测试员和安全研究人员提供了广泛的工具。它包含 Python 3 解释器以及广泛的模块库,这些模块库用于各种安全相关任务。本文将深入探讨 Kali 中 Python 3 模块的环境位置,并提供有关如何管理和使用这些模块的见解。
模块位置
Kali 中 Python 3 模块位于以下路径:
/usr/lib/python3/dist-packages/
此目录包含许多子目录,每个子目录都包含一个或多个 Python 模块。例如:
/usr/lib/python3/dist-packages/requests/
目录包含requests
模块,该模块用于发送 HTTP 请求。/usr/lib/python3/dist-packages/scapy/
目录包含scapy
模块,该模块用于网络协议分析。/usr/lib/python3/dist-packages/beautifulsoup4/
目录包含beautifulsoup4
模块,该模块用于 HTML 解析。
管理模块
Kali 中 Python 3 模块可以通过以下方法进行管理:
- 安装模块:可以使用
pip
包管理器来安装新模块。 - 卸载模块:可以使用
pip
包管理器来卸载模块。 - 更新模块:可以使用
pip
包管理器来更新模块。 - 查看已安装的模块:可以使用以下命令查看已安装的模块列表:
pip list
使用模块
要使用 Python 3 模块,您需要在您的脚本中导入该模块。可以使用 import
语句来实现此目的。例如,要导入 requests
模块,您需要在您的脚本中添加以下代码:
import requests
然后,您可以使用模块的函数和类。例如,要发送 HTTP GET 请求,您可以使用以下代码:
response = requests.get('https://example.com/')
常见问题解答
1. 如何查找有关特定模块的更多信息?
您可以使用以下命令查看有关特定模块的文档:
pydoc <module_name>
例如,要查看有关 requests
模块的文档,您可以运行以下命令:
pydoc requests
2. 如何知道哪些模块已经安装?
可以使用以下命令查看已安装的模块列表:
pip list
3. 如何在 Kali 中安装新模块?
可以使用以下命令安装新模块:
pip install <module_name>
例如,要安装 scapy
模块,您可以运行以下命令:
pip install scapy
4. 如何从 Kali 中卸载模块?
可以使用以下命令卸载模块:
pip uninstall <module_name>
例如,要卸载 beautifulsoup4
模块,您可以运行以下命令:
pip uninstall beautifulsoup4
5. 如何更新 Kali 中的模块?
可以使用以下命令更新模块:
pip install --upgrade <module_name>
例如,要更新 requests
模块,您可以运行以下命令:
pip install --upgrade requests
结论
Kali 中的 Python 3 模块位于 /usr/lib/python3/dist-packages/
目录中。这些模块可用于广泛的安全相关任务,并且可以通过 pip
包管理器进行管理。通过了解 Python 3 模块的管理和使用,您可以扩大 Kali 的功能并执行更高级的安全分析和任务。
原创文章,作者:王利头,如若转载,请注明出处:https://www.wanglitou.cn/article_37822.html